Zuneg & The Doom Choir - If I Should Die


A 140 year-old piano takes centre-stage in this death-laden recording by Zuneg and The Doom Choir. It makes you wonder what tunes, over the years, have been hammered out on its keyboard? I suspect nothing quite as experimental and absorbing as If I Should Die. The track takes trip-hop and mangles it into a spooky requiem, complete with extreme vocals provided by The Doom Choir, members of which include Aaron Shipp, Aaron Skouge (Stronghold) and René Gosch (Sick Girl). The result is a wonderfully off-kilter, gothic recording which almost creaks across the floorboards as you listen.
